Cusiter Quits Rugby To Focus On Selling Scotch

Written 2 years ago by Will O'Callaghan


Scotland scrum-half Chris Cusiter has retired from professional rugby with immediate effect at 33.

He says it’s the right time to end his playing career – and that he’ll now build a retail business in Los Angeles which will focus on Scotch whisky.

Cusiter also toured with the British and Irish Lions in 2005.
